Info please, my friend has been divorced a few years now and decided to sell her rings. Rather than just selling for the platinum value, she wants to get as much as possible for them.
What's the best way of selling now?

Thanks in advance

The unfortunate truth is she will only get a fraction of the original cost so she may be disappointed.

Take them to a few reputable jewellers who purchase jewellery and compare offers.

I sold one - two shops - one was half the price of the other - so worth shopping around

BUT I don't think second hand diamonds have as much value as you'd think - they sell for scrap

What are the rings? If they are decent size/quality of diamond she may do best selling privately on loupetroop or diamond bistro. Does she have appraisals or GIA certs with them?

Certain styles are unfashionable and only value is in the scrap weight.

If it's something fairly classic private sale may be possible. Don't rule out ebay.

If the rings are antique with decent diamonds, I know a dealer I can put her in touch with to sell on her behalf.
